Computer Networking Degrees


Networks are crucial for the use of computers in business. Trained professionals are the need of the hour in the current scenario of brisk growth in technology and telecommunication industry. Computer networking involves the planning, execution, and building of various databases and using internet-based applications to configure each project. There is a tremendous potential for trained networking experts to manage these specialized systems. A vocation in Network management involves troubleshooting network issues, setting up security measures; execute new technologies for increased efficiency of computers for the end users.
The U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) has envisaged a bright prospective for computer systems administrators who will be in-charge of building, installing the local network as well as the internet.
Majority of employers require a degree for positions in computer networking, even though other certifications may also be required, but a degree can be a step towards that first job.
Computer network degree can be obtained through regular college or by training program with institutes or through an online course. However Online Networking degree is relatively easy to obtain since one can earn it from the comforts of home by streamlining the course work and classes for weekends. Working individuals can utilize the excellent online universities for gaining a network degree.
Network degree programs often include coursework in local and wide area networking, authentication schemes, network security, directory services, various operating systems, Network Analysis and Troubleshooting, Application Performance Analysis, Internet Protocol Fundamentals, Advanced Internet Protocol Concepts, IP Analysis and Troubleshooting etc. Besides this Degree programs may also offer hands-on learning through virtual lab environments.
Networking degree will cater to specialization in various areas of networking and database management. One can study the different aspects of Networking that includes information technology, telecommunication and networking, database analysis, systems analysis, etc.
Network security degree programs are heavily focused on increasing security and developing new systems for data encryption and protection. Network security degree courses may also include current threats and viruses, troubleshooting, and data-linking techniques.
Completion of the Networking degree can entitle one for jobs as network administrators, network support specialist, database administrators, network security technician etc. Experienced graduates are in demand for senior network management and executive IT management positions.
